Unconventional myosin that functions as actin-based motor protein with ATPase activity. Plays a role in endosomal protein trafficking, and especially in the transfer of cargo proteins from early to recycling endosomes. Required for normal planar cell polarity in ciliated tracheal cells, for normal rotational polarity of cilia, and for coordinated, unidirectional ciliary movement in the trachea. Required for normal, polarized cilia organization in brain ependymal epithelial cells.
